SMPD arrests man for deadly conduct

Friday, August 2, 2019

San Marcos Police arrested a man Thursday night after responding to a report of shots fired in the area of Crest Drive. 

Witnesses also reported gunshots in the area of Hillcrest and Craddock Ave around 11:09 p.m. Thursday. A white passenger car fired rounds at an older BMW model in the cul-de-sac of Crest Drive, according to witnesses. Officers caught up with the car and conducted a high-risk stop. The driver of the white car called SMPD to report that he was being followed and didn’t know why before being stopped, SMPD said. 

The driver and sole occupant of the car was identified as Dillon Snethkamp, 20, and admitted to having a handgun in his vehicle, officials said. Snethkamp claimed that he was “just leaving a friend’s residence,” but changed his account after he was confronted with what witnesses saw. 

According to SMPD, Snethkamp admitted that he contacted another male through social media and arranged a meeting to purchase marijuana. The unidentified man pulled out a handgun during the purchase and robbed Snethkamp of his money. 

The male returned to his BMW and began to drive away. Snethkamp followed the man and as he made a U-turn at end of Crest Drive, Snethkamp fired at least two shots and the male’s vehicle and they passed each other, officers said. 

 Snethkamp was arrested and charged with Deadly Conduct, Possession Of Controlled Substance and Unauthorized Carry-Weapon after an investigation. The BMW driver’s whereabouts are unknown and it is unclear if there are any gunshot victims, SMPD said. 

Snethkamp is currently being held in jail with a $25,000 bond.
